Size

Is West Virginia bigger than Barbados?

The total area of West Virginia is 24,230 sq mi, and the total area of Barbados is 169 sq mi. West Virginia is bigger than Barbados by 24,061 sq mi. West Virginia is around 143.37 times bigger than Barbados.

Population

According to the United States Census Bureau, the total population of West Virginia as of 1st July 2021 was estimated to be around 1,782,959.

Population of West Virginia compared to Barbados

Based on the World Bank data, the total population of Barbados as of 2020, was estimated to be around 287,371.
